Cursor CLI — основы
Cursor CLI — терминальный AI-агент от Cursor. Агентное кодирование прямо в терминале без IDE: агент читает, пишет и редактирует код, запускает команды, работает с git — всё через командную строку.
Установка
macOS / Linux / WSL:
bash
curl https://cursor.com/install -fsS | bashWindows (PowerShell):
powershell
irm 'https://cursor.com/install?win32=true' | iexПроверка:
bash
agent --versionЕсли команда не найдена — добавить ~/.local/bin в PATH (zsh):
bash
echo 'export PATH="$HOME/.local/bin:$PATH"' >> ~/.zshrc && source ~/.zshrcЗапуск
bash
# Интерактивная сессия
agent
# Сразу с промптом
agent "описание задачи"
# История сессий
agent ls
# Продолжить последнюю сессию
agent resumeВыбор модели
По умолчанию Cursor CLI может использовать разные модели. Рекомендация — Claude Opus как наиболее мощная модель для агентного кодинга.
Внутри сессии — команда /model, покажет список доступных моделей и позволит переключиться без перезапуска.
Режимы работы
- Agent (по умолчанию) — полный доступ к инструментам, пишет и редактирует код, запускает команды
- Plan (
/planилиShift+Tab) — проектирование подхода перед кодингом, без изменений в файлах - Ask (
/askилиShift+Tab) — только чтение и анализ кода, без изменений
Советы
- Контекст через
@. Указывайте файлы через@путь/к/файлудля добавления в контекст агента. - Сжатие контекста.
/compress— сжать историю если беседа стала длинной и агент теряет фокус.
Доступ
Если у вас нет доступа к Cursor — напишите Сергею Романкову: s.romankov@ventra.ru.